Scalping strategy
The most popular forex scalping strategy is the scalping strategy. This strategy involves small profits and short positions. Because it requires ultra-fast reaction times, scalpers must enter and exit trades in a matter of seconds or minutes. They closely monitor price charts to identify patterns. Sometimes they use tick charts that are short-term. Scalper performs well with tight spreads, guaranteed order execution, and high levels of certainty. He prefers little order slippage.

What is a Stock Exchange?
A stock exchange is where companies go to sell shares of their company. This allows investors to purchase shares in the company. The market sets the price of the share. It is usually based on how much people are willing to pay for the company.
The stock exchange also helps companies raise money from investors. Investors are willing to invest capital in order for companies to grow. They buy shares in the company. Companies use their money to fund their projects and expand their business.
There are many kinds of shares that can be traded on a stock exchange. Others are known as ordinary shares. These are most common types of shares. These shares can be bought and sold on the open market. The prices of shares are determined by demand and supply.
Preferred shares and bonds are two types of shares. When dividends are paid out, preferred shares have priority above other shares. A company issue bonds called debt securities, which must be repaid.

How to Trade on the Stock Market
Stock trading refers to the act of buying and selling stocks or bonds, commodities, currencies, derivatives, and other securities. Trading is French for "trading", which means someone who buys or sells. Traders sell and buy securities to make profit. It is one of the oldest forms of financial investment.
There are many different ways to invest on the stock market. There are three main types of investing: active, passive, and hybrid. Passive investors do nothing except watch their investments grow while actively traded investors try to pick winning companies and profit from them. Hybrid investors use a combination of these two approaches.
Passive investing is done through index funds that track broad indices like the S&P 500 or Dow Jones Industrial Average, etc. This approach is very popular because it allows you to reap the benefits of diversification without having to deal directly with the risk involved. All you have to do is relax and let your investments take care of themselves.
Active investing is about picking specific companies to analyze their performance. Active investors will look at things such as earnings growth, return on equity, debt ratios, P/E ratio, cash flow, book value, dividend payout, management team, share price history, etc. They will then decide whether or no to buy shares in the company.
